You Make Me A Flower


“I cross my heart and promise to
Give all I've got to give to make all your dreams come true
In all the world you'll never find
A love as true as mine”
(Quoted lines from I cross my heart by George Strait)
When my enticed eyes look at you
My heart pulsates with the cadence new 
My soul absorbs your essence completely
Suffusing my senses with the feeling of glee.

“As I stand alone on this moon full night
For the first time I feel alone in life”
(Quoted lines from I’m ready for love by Martha Reeves)
Your alluring footprints I long to follow
To embrace you all the way I’ll go
When I feel empty and alone, I stand 
At the edge of dark horizon in wasteland
You raise for me the silver moon high
Forever my love shines in night’s jeweled sky.

“I told you everything
Opened up and let you in
You made me feel alright for once in my life”
(Quoted lines from Behind those hazel eyes by Kelly Clarkson)
In the scorched existence, listless and inert 
When I turn into a dry lake in the desert
You bring the soothing rains of bliss 
Make within me a sparkling oasis. 

“All alone am I ever since your goodbye
All alone with just the beat of my heart”
(Quoted lines from All alone am I by Brenda Lee)
Wandering lost in the vale of desolation
I search for the missing passion 
In the abandoned channel meandering
You flow the torrent of your yearning
Make a cascading river of desire in me surge
Flowing joyfully to the rapturous sea.

“It was hard for me to see when
When your love was blindin' me
But now, I know I have to let you go your separate way”
(Quoted lines from Learn the hard way by Brandy Norwood) 
In the burnt garden in summer of despair
When I appear as a wilting bud I feel you’d care
Bring rains and drench me again in love shower
Make me blossom for you as a radiant flower.

(The lines from the mentioned songs of the named singers 
are within quotation.)
